Price Comparison

When it comes to price, the Soozier Exercise Bike is significantly more affordable at C$179.99 compared to the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ike, which is priced at C$699.99. This difference of C$520 indicates that the Soozier model is designed for budget-conscious consumers looking for basic features without the premium bells and whistles. The Niceday bike, on the other hand, is positioned as a high-end option with advanced features tailored for serious fitness enthusiasts or those requiring a supportive exercise solution, especially for rehabilitation purposes.

Features Overview

The Soozier Exercise Bike offers customizable resistance, providing users with a tailored fitness experience. It features a whisper-quiet belt drive, which makes it ideal for home use where noise may be a concern. In contrast, the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ike boasts a 15-pound flywheel and 16 levels of adjustable mechanical resistance, facilitating a smooth and quiet workout while catering to a broader range of fitness levels and rehabilitation needs. Its design prioritizes comfort and ease of use, making it suitable for users with physical limitations.

Comfort and Ergonomics

Comfort is an essential factor in workout equipment, and the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ike excels in this area. It features an ergonomic seat with a high-density soft sponge cushion and a breathable mesh backrest, designed to reduce discomfort during extended workouts. The seat can be adjusted to accommodate users up to 6'3" in height, providing ample legroom. While the Soozier Exercise Bike does allow for seat and handlebar adjustments, it does not incorporate the same level of ergonomic design, making it less suitable for those who may require added support during exercise.

Weight Capacity

In terms of weight capacity, the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ike significantly outperforms the Soozier model. The Niceday bike supports a maximum weight of 400 lbs, making it a versatile choice for a wider range of users, including families. In contrast, the Soozier Exercise Bike has a lower maximum load capacity of 264 lbs. This difference may influence the decision of heavier users or those looking to share the equipment among multiple family members.

Ease of Use

The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ike is designed with user-friendliness in mind, coming 90% pre-assembled, which simplifies the setup process. Its integrated transport wheels also enhance mobility and storage options. The Soozier Exercise Bike, while functional, may require more effort to assemble and move due to its heavier construction. This aspect makes the Niceday bike more appealing for individuals who value convenience and ease of use in their fitness equipment.

Technology and Tracking

Both bikes feature an integrated LCD monitor that tracks essential workout data such as time, speed, distance, and calories burned. However, the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ike goes a step further by also tracking pulse and includes an iPad holder, enhancing the user experience and allowing for entertainment during workouts. The Soozier Exercise Bike provides basic tracking without the additional features that may be attractive to tech-savvy users or those who enjoy multimedia while exercising.

Target Audience

The Soozier Exercise Bike is ideal for casual cyclists and beginners who are looking for a straightforward, budget-friendly option to start their fitness journey. Its simplicity and lower price make it accessible for those who may not have extensive fitness goals. Conversely, the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ike targets a more specific audience, including individuals requiring physical therapy or those who prioritize comfort and advanced functionality in their fitness regimen. The higher price point reflects its comprehensive features designed for diverse fitness needs.

Which should you buy?

In conclusion, the choice between the Soozier Exercise Bike and the Niceday Recumbent Exercise Bike ultimately depends on individual needs and budget. If you're seeking an economical option for basic workouts, the Soozier bike is a solid choice at C$179.99. However, for those needing a more robust, comfortable, and feature-rich exercise solution, the Niceday bike at C$699.99 provides superior support, adjustable features, and enhanced tracking capabilities, making it worth the investment.
